With all the snow and low temperatures the Winter of 2013-14 seemed like it would never end.  But looking back at photos from this time last year, native plant growth is only a week or so behind 2013.  I almost did not venture out into the woods for an informal survey, but I'm glad I did.  While only a few native species were in bloom, many have broken ground and are forming flower buds.  Here are some photos of the highlights.

When walking through the woods, it pays to look up once in a while.
Many of the native spring wild flowers most active while the tree canopy is open.  Now they have have enough light to photosynthesize and store up energy.  Once the trees leaf out there is not enough light for these plants to continue to grow so many of them shut down for the summer.  These plants are known as the spring ephemerals.  

The first plants I noticed were the Virginia Bluebells, Mertensia virginica.  These first appear as purplish-gray buds through the leaf litter.  If last year is a guide they should be blooming in about 2 weeks.
As the leaves of these Virginia Bluebells mature they lose the purplish blush.

I was surprised to see the Spring Beauties in bloom.  There are only a few of them now.  Their number should continue to increase into May.  These grow from corms, so technically they are native bulbs.  If I happen to dig up any later this spring I will move them up into the bulb gardens closer to the house.  
These blooms are mostly white, pinkish ones appear later in the season.

The finely divided foliage of Dutchman's Breeches, Dicentra cucullaria, is also making an appearance.  I don't know if this species can be distinguished from Squirrel Corn, D. canadensis, just by the foliage.  I am making the assignment based on only seeing the former species last year.

The new foliage of all 3 eastern Dicentra species is very similar.
Off to the right are some leaves from Spring Beauties.

White Avens, Geum canadense, will bloom until later in the summer, but it is producing fresh foliage now.  It is recognizable by its deeply divided gray-green foliage.

One of the large basal leaves of White Avens  is at the lower right in the photo above.  

I saw a lot of leaves of Toothwort, Cardamine diphylla, and a few with flower buds. I also saw some leaves of cut-leaved Toothwort, C. laciniata.  These have similar coloration, but the leaves are deeply cut into five or more fingers.  These species were formally classified in the genus Dentaria.

The new growth was not limited to the perennials.  The shrubs are also beginning to bloom.  I got this American Hazelnut, Corylus americana, last fall.  It was bearing several nut clusters which grew to maturity last season.  This spring I only noticed the small red female flowers.  There were no male catkins on the shrub.  I don't know if their absence is due to the cold, or the deer.

I would have missed seeing the buds forming on this Yellowroot, Xanthorhiza simplicissima, if I had not remembered where it was planted.  The tops of the plant had been 'cut' back a bit.  Again, I don't know if this was from frost damage or deer browse.  
The flower buds of Spicebush, Lindera benzoin, are about to burst.  The flowering time of Spicebush is similar to Forsythia, but the color of the Spicebush is much more delicate.  In a week or so this area will be in a yellow haze of Spicebush flowers.  
Close examination of a Spicebush branch shows that the flower buds occur in pairs.

Native Bulbs

Scilla growing under a Sargent Crabapple
at Mount Auburn Cemetery, Cambridge, MA.
Spring is ushered in by a plethora of flowering bulbs. Despite my inclination toward natives I still plant all kinds of exotic bulbs. I especially like seeing the blue carpets of Scilla under trees and Crocus sprouting randomly in a lawn. So last fall, this got me thinking, what about native bulbs?


Crocus tommasiniansus between Prairie Dropseed mounds.










Some native bulbs that I knew of were Trout Lily (Erythronium americanum), Bloodroot (Sanguinaria canadensis) and Camas (Camassia sp.). To check for more ideas I did a search of the USDA Plants Database looking for North American natives that are propagated from bulbs gave a list of 30 plants, including Alliums, Camassia, Iris and Sisyrinchium angustifolium (Blue-eyed grass). For corms, 17 Species were listed including Dicentra, Hypoxis (Yellow Star grass) and Liatris. (Note that all of the data for every single plant in this database is not fully stocked, so there are gaps, but it is still a useful tool, especially at the Genus-level.)

I decided to focus on the first three. Finding a source for these plants was not trivial, but after many hours on the internet I found a nursery in West Virginia that propagated their own natives: Sunshine Farm and Gardens.  Also, they had all of the species I was after – one stop shopping!

No bloom on this one.

My best result, so far, has been with the Trout Lily, aka Dogtooth Violet, which began sprouting up in early April. At first it blended in with the early tulip foliage, but they distinguished themselves by the mottled coloration on the topside of the leaf. This coloration can be likened to that of a trout. (The backside of this leaf was a flat green, just like the tulip foliage.) A second plant, this one with a bloom, was initially more elusive, but certainly worth finding. Once opened, this small flower was hard to miss. this bloom lasted 7-10 days.  As these were rather small bulbs when I put them in, I may have lost them amongst the Tulips in the leafy mulch that I used.  These plants will spread by stolons, so if they are happy, I will eventually have a good sized patch.

Most of the Camassia that are easily available are cultivars of species native to the Western US, like the Small Camas, Camassia quamash. The only species of Camassia native to the Eastern US is the Atlantic Camas, Camassia scilloides, with a native range from Georgia to Pennsylvania and west to Texas. Since Camas prefers moister areas, I did not save any for myself, but I did put some in for clients with more appropriate conditions (also where I did do a map). So I will be paying them a visit soon to see how they are doing. The Atlantic Camas has a preference for limestone-rich soils, so it may be a good choice in a residential setting for planting near a foundation.
